## 4.2.0 — Changed Defaults

The Lintmere baseline file (`lintmere.baseline`) is now generated per-module instead of per-repo. Plugin authors: findings suppressed by the old monolithic baseline will resurface until you regenerate. The `strictNew` flag now defaults to on. Regeneration respects the settings below, which ship as the new defaults.

settings of tawig-hawef:
[zorath]
port = 7000
region = north-1
host = zorath.tolvaqworks.corp
timeout_ms = 1000
retries = 1

## Account Recovery — Trailnote Offline Mode

When a surveyor's Trailnote app has been offline for 30+ days, their local credentials expire and sync refuses to resume. Don't make them wipe the device — all their unsynced field data lives there! Instead, open the support console, pick "Offline Reinstate," and enter their handle. The console will ask for the support team's shared recovery passphrase before issuing a reinstatement token. Use the one below.

unlock words, bagaf-fajeg: zorael-kelax-fraath-quenix-eliok-sileth-aldmir-wenir-druiel

Runbook: Pipewing websocket gateway — compression. permessage-deflate cuts bandwidth ~60% but spikes CPU on reconnect storms. If gateway CPU >80% during an incident, disable compression via the feature flag; clients fall back transparently. Expect egress costs to roughly double while disabled. Do not toggle per-node; flag applies fleet-wide. Re-enable only after reconnect rate returns to baseline for 15 minutes. Benchmarks, flag name, and rollback steps are on the internal page.

dashboard of yaguf-hahig = https://grafana.urlaqworks.test/secrets